I should add that I've done OK promoting 3D Kink from KinkyDollars, which like the Red Light product has the advantage of being impossible to pirate, and has prettier avatars. But the products aren't competitors at all. I like to describe 3D Kink as being like "paper dolls for grownups" ... you can dress and undress the avatars, pose them, play with them, make them orgasm, earn coins to buy more sex toys and clothes and stuff, but there's no multiplayer, no social aspect, no cybersex, no other people.
Selling 3D Kink properly is also a lot of work. It's like blogging, I don't mind telling people how to do it, because nobody will take the advice. You can't just send people to the signup page, or put up the banners; that fails miserably (bad ratios). I find I've actually got to use the product, play with it at time-consuming length, take screen shots, and use them to illustrate blog posts. When people see that ... when they see that I'm telling my own story with pretty pictures I made with the product ... then they get interested and are more inclined to buy. |

?Unlimited access to VIP-only regions, content and features ?Private messenging ?Private apartment ?Advanced Avatar Customization ?VWW Population Capacity of 10 people ?Virtual Currency Transactions Universal VIP - from $29.99/month ?All VIP-Only features listed above plus... ?Raises VWW Population Capacity to 25 people ?Grants the member a "Universal VIP" pass ?Unlocks the ability to purchase larger VWW Population Capacities ?Additional VWW features such as advanced tools, stats, Ad discounts I would recommend the PPS route. Reason? 60% recurring of $20 is $12, which means they have to stay at least 5 months for you to get the same as the PPS option. With my traffic, they were averaging 2-3 months membership. |
